Produktbeschreibung
INTERWOVEN, the first volume in the Points of Failure series by H.E. Wallace and Roi Qualls, plunges us into a post-conflict world 250 years into the future when humanity faces its starkest choice: escape or perish. With only 85 years remaining before Earth can no longer support human life, the Umoja-19 mission to the center of the galaxy in search of a new home planet cannot fail. When things do not go as planned, Chief Scientist Dr. Tah Morant must figure out why. His investigation takes an unforeseen turn, but is complicated by personal tensions, childhood trauma, fickle friendships, and brittle intimacies of marriage. To make matters worse, he must steer clear of danger and political intrigue while navigating with a moral compass clouded by willful ignorance and personal revenge. This isn't merely science fiction; it's a journey into social and personal transformation, the relentless pursuit of truth, and the deep spiritual strength required for our survival. It explores the complexities of human nature and the intricate cultural structures that persist even after war has been abolished. INTERWOVEN reflects on our complicity, our courage, and the choices we face in shaping what comes next for planet Earth. This isn't a dystopian warning or a utopian escape, but a vital call to self-examination and transformation, particularly in the face of the calamities- physical, cultural, spiritual, political- shaping our current reality.
Autorenporträt
Compelling stories have always captured H.E. Wallace's attention. INTERWOVEN, her debut novel, ties together her love for a good story and the dream of writing one. Before becoming a writer, she earned her clinical doctorate for physical therapy and worked as a licensed physical therapist. That role gave her a chance to help people in her community, but left little room for creative expression. In 2020, in a leap of faith, she left her job to start over. The years that followed brought their share of uncertainty and underemployment, but they also sparked a deeper understanding: true transformation-both personal and collective-often begins with spirituality and the arts. Together with her co-author, Roi Qualls, she founded Knowetix to explore these themes. Through their work, they hope to inspire others to grow, create, and build stronger communities.Beyond writing, H.E. Wallace's interests include reading, visual arts; music, audiobooks, and podcasts; threadworks, nature walks, and travel. She currently lives in a seaside Washington town near her mother who was the first to encourage her to write.
